关于用户自定义数据类型的说法错误的是______。
A: 可以用Type语句创建用户定义的类型,该语句必须置于模块的声明部分
B: 用户定义类型可以用适当的关键字声明为Private或Public
C: 对于两个属于同一个用户定义类型的变量,不能将其中一个变量赋给另一个变量
D: 对同一种用户定义类型,可以声明为局部的、私有的或公用的模块级变量
A: 可以用Type语句创建用户定义的类型,该语句必须置于模块的声明部分
B: 用户定义类型可以用适当的关键字声明为Private或Public
C: 对于两个属于同一个用户定义类型的变量,不能将其中一个变量赋给另一个变量
D: 对同一种用户定义类型,可以声明为局部的、私有的或公用的模块级变量
C
举一反三
- 下列关于声明变量的说法中,错误的是____________。 A: 用显式声明变量的关键字Dim,Private,Static或Public来声明变量的类型 B: 用类型说明符标记变量类型,类型说明符有:%,&,!,#,@,$ C: 用DefType语句声明变量的类型,其中Type是类型标志 D: 用Type/End Type语句声明记录类型变量
- 下面关于变量说法正确的是() A: 变量声明包括基本数据类型和用户定义类型。 B: 全局变量是用Public声明的变量,局部变量是用Dim或Static等声明的变量 C: 全局变量和局部变量不能同名 D: 任何窗体和模块对全局变量的修改都会影响其他窗体或模块
- 下面关于变量说法正确的是() A: A变量声明包括基本数据类型和用户定义类型。 B: B全局变量是用Public声明的变量,局部变量是用Dim或Static等声明的变量 C: C全局变量和局部变量不能同名 D: D任何窗体和模块对全局变量的修改都会影响其他窗体或模块
- 对于用户自定义的数据类型,以下4种描述中,错误的是______。 A: 记录类型中的字符串必须是定长字符串 B: 其变量如果在窗体模块中定义,则必须加关键字Private C: 记录类型的定义必须放在模块的声明部分,先定义再使用 D: 数据类型元素名可以是任何数据类型
- 用户自定义数据类型是用类型定义语句____和子类型定义语句____实现的。
内容
- 0
声明变量时必须定义一个类型。 ( )
- 1
VB中 定义变量最简单的方法是用( )关键字,用( )定义常量, 结构体类型定义是把控制权交给用户的方法,它让用户可以定义自己的数据类型,使用关键字()
- 2
关于VHDL数据类型,正确的是 A: 用户不能定义子类型 B: 用户可以定义子类型 C: 用户可以定义任何类型的数据 D: 前面三个答案都是错误的
- 3
关于用户变量和局部变量的说法,下面正确的是________。 A: 用户变量和局部变量在定义时都以“@”符号开头,它们之间只有作用域不同 B: 用户变量使用DECLARE语句定义,而局部变量需要使用SET语句声明 C: 用户变量通过SET语句定义,而局部变量需要使用DECLARE语句声明 D: 局部变量在定义时需要以“@”符号开头,而用户变量不需要使用这个符号
- 4
下列有关typedef的说法中,正确的是 A: typedef可以用来定义新的数据类型 B: 用typedef既可以声明新的类型名,又可以定义变量 C: 用typedef不能定义新的数据类型,但可以定义变量 D: typedef只用来声明新的类型名,不产生新的数据类型,也不可以定义变量